Vendor note: the driver-assignment heuristic in dispatch is licensed from Ferrowick Logistics and shipped as a sealed binary. We cannot patch it directly; tuning happens only through the weights file in `config/assignment`. Ferrowick reviews proposed weight changes within five business days, so plan releases accordingly. Maintainers should log every tuning request in the vendor tracker and send the request to the address below.

escalation mailbox, bafog-fafog: ulador@paliqlabs.internal

Welcome to on-call for the Glimmerpane design system! Our snapshot tests live in the `snapcheck` suite and run on every merge to main. If a UI component changes visually, the diff bot flags it — usually it's an intentional tweak, so just approve the new baseline. If it's 2am and snapshots are failing across the board, it's almost always a font-loading race, not your problem. To unlock the baseline store and re-approve snapshots in bulk, use the recovery passphrase below.

recovery phrase for tahag-taguf: wenix-caswyn

- Fixed clipped line items on invoices with more than 40 rows; tables now paginate correctly.
- Currency symbols for multi-region accounts render in the correct locale instead of defaulting to the Veldmark format.
- Reduced render time for large invoices by roughly 30%.
- Watermarks on draft invoices are now lighter and no longer obscure totals.

If customers report rendering artifacts after this release, collect the invoice number and escalate directly. Responsibility for this release sits with the renderer lead.

named custodian: Oliath Ralax

## Account Recovery — Splitwick Assignment Service

If the A/B experiment assignment service loses its admin account (usually after a failed credential rotation), don't panic — assignments keep serving from cache. Re-bootstrap the admin user via the recovery console on the ops bastion. The console will ask for the service's recovery passphrase, which is:

vault phrase of kawep-tahog = ulaix-briath